Why Nantucket?

An island of pristine beauty located 30 miles off the coast of Cape Cod, Nantucket offers a unique blend of history, preservation, and coastal living. Spanning 14 miles long and 3.5 miles wide, the island features over 40% conservation land and miles of publicly accessible beaches.

Known as the “Little Grey Lady of the Sea,” Nantucket is defined by its grey-shingled architecture, historic charm, and absence of traffic lights, neon signs, and chain establishments, preserving a character unlike anywhere else. Designated as a National Historic Landmark, the island includes more than 800 pre-Civil War homes and one of the highest concentrations of historic properties in Massachusetts.

With a year-round population of approximately 14,000 that grows to over 60,000 in the summer, Nantucket offers both a strong sense of community and a dynamic environment. This is a rare opportunity to contribute to a community that values both its heritage and its future.
